PLSQL Developer 的java classes红叉实际上是指PLSQL Developer中Java类的编译错误。在本文中,我将向你介绍如何解决这个问题,并指导你完成整个流程。
1. 理解PLSQL Developer 的java classes红叉问题
在开始之前,让我们先来了解一下PLSQL Developer 的java classes红叉问题。当你的Java类在PLSQL Developer中出现红叉时,意味着该类存在编译错误,无法成功加载和运行。这可能是由于语法错误、缺失的依赖库或其他相关问题导致的。
解决这个问题的关键是定位并修复编译错误。接下来,我将向你展示解决PLSQL Developer 的java classes红叉问题的步骤。
2. 解决PLSQL Developer 的java classes红叉问题的步骤
下表展示了解决PLSQL Developer 的java classes红叉问题的步骤:
步骤 | 描述 |
---|---|
1. | 定位红叉所在的Java类文件 |
2. | 分析红叉所指示的编译错误 |
3. | 修复编译错误 |
4. | 重新编译并加载Java类 |
接下来,我将详细说明每个步骤需要做什么,并提供相关的代码示例和注释。
2.1 定位红叉所在的Java类文件
首先,你需要找到红叉所在的Java类文件。通常,PLSQL Developer会在红叉所在的行号旁边显示具体的错误信息。你可以使用文本编辑器或PLSQL Developer内置的查找功能来定位该文件。
2.2 分析红叉所指示的编译错误
接下来,你需要仔细分析红叉所指示的编译错误。这些错误信息通常会提供有关错误类型、具体位置和原因的线索。根据错误信息,你可以确定需要修复的问题,并采取相应的措施。
2.3 修复编译错误
根据分析的错误信息,你可以开始修复编译错误。这可能涉及到修改代码、添加缺失的依赖库或其他必要的操作。以下是几个常见的修复编译错误的示例:
- 修复语法错误:根据错误信息修改代码中存在的语法错误,例如拼写错误、缺少分号等。
- 添加缺失的依赖库:如果错误信息指示缺少某个依赖库,你需要添加该库到项目的构建路径中。
- 解决命名冲突:如果错误信息指示存在命名冲突,你需要修改相关的类或方法名称以解决冲突。
2.4 重新编译并加载Java类
修复了编译错误后,你需要重新编译并加载Java类。在PLSQL Developer中,你可以通过使用“Compile All Java”或“Compile Selected Java”选项来实现。这将编译项目中的所有Java类或指定的Java类。
以下是一个示例,展示了如何使用PLSQL Developer编译Java类的代码:
--#注释:编译所有Java类
BEGIN
DBMS_JAVA.COMPILE_CLASSES();
END;
/
--#注释:编译指定的Java类
BEGIN
DBMS_JAVA.COMPILE_CLASS('<类名>');
END;
/
这样,你就完成了解决PLSQL Developer 的java classes红叉问题的所有步骤。
3. 关系图和类图
在解决PLSQL Developer 的java classes红叉问题的过程中,关系图和类图可以帮助你更好地理解和分析代码结构和依赖关系。
下面是使用mermaid语法绘制的一个关系图的示例:
erDiagram
classA ||--o{ classB : "关联关系"
classA }|--|{ classC : "组合关系"
classA }|..|{ classD : "聚合关系"